Southard, Rupert Barron was born on April 8, 1923 in St. Johnsbury, Vermont, United States. Son of Rupert Barron and Kathleen Wilhelmina (Larvey) Southard.
Student, U. Rochester, 1943-1944; student, Syracuse University, 1941-1942, 47-48; Bachelor of Civil Engineering, Syracuse University, 1949.
With, United States Geological Survey, Reston, Virginia, 1949-1991;
member program staff topographic division, United States Geological Survey, Reston, Virginia, 1960-1961;
chief, United States Geological Survey, Reston, Virginia, 1965-1970;
associate chief topographic division, United States Geological Survey, Reston, Virginia, 1970-1978;
chief, United States Geological Survey, Reston, Virginia, 1978-1979;
chief national mapping division, United States Geological Survey, Reston, Virginia, 1979-1986;
retired, United States Geological Survey, Reston, Virginia, 1986. Member of faculty, consultant USDA Graduate School, 1957-1970. Member Federal Mapping Task Force, 1972-1973.
United States member Commision on Cartography, Pan American Institute Geography and History, 1977-1986. Chairman Federal Interagy. Committee for Digital Cartography Coordination.
Member United States Board on Geography Names, 1981-1990, chairman, 1988-1990.
Served with United States Marine Corps, 1943-1946, 50-52. Fellow American Congress on Surveying and Mapping. Member American Society Photogrammetry, Antarctican Society.
Married Jean FrancesScott, July 7, 1945. Children— John Scott, Kathleen, Timothy Will, Matthew Barron, Ann, Joseph Rupert.
